- The distance between Lihue, Kauai, Hawaii and Marquette, Michigan, Usa is approximately 6,883 km or 4,277 mi.
- To reach Lihue, Kauai in this distance one would set out from Marquette, Michigan bearing 273.1°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Lihue, Kauai bearing 227.8° or SW .
- Lihue, Kauai has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As) whereas Marquette, Michigan has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- The mean temperature is 20.3 °C (36.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.2 °C (45.4°F) less in Lihue, Kauai.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 195.4 mm (7.7 in) more which is equivalent to 195.4 l/m² (4.8 US gal/ft²) or 1,954,000 l/ha (208,896 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/9 as much.
- There are 219 more hours of sunlight per year in Lihue, Kauai. In whichever way circa 0h 36' more per day or about 1 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.2° higher in Lihue, Kauai than in Marquette, Michigan.
- Relative humidity levels are 1.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 19°C (34.2°F) higher.
